If the Jeep originally had a 2.5L, then the 2.8L V6 will bolt up to the Jeep AX5 tranny with the stock 2.5L bellhousing. You'll have to use the 2.8L flywheel. If the Jeep originally had a 4.0 in it and still has the AX15 tranny, then you'll have to use a 96-00 Dodge Dakota 2.5L bellhousing and a Camaro flywheel. Probably not worth all of this effort.
